As per Market Research Future analysis, the Electric Propulsion System Market was estimated at 5.483 USD Billion in 2024. The Electric Propulsion System industry is projected to grow from 6.17 USD Billion in 2025 to 20.06 USD Billion by 2035, exhibiting a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 12.51% during the forecast period 2025 - 2035.
The electric propulsion system market is witnessing strong momentum as aerospace, marine, and space industries shift toward cleaner and more efficient propulsion technologies. Increasing fuel efficiency requirements and stricter emission regulations are encouraging manufacturers to adopt electric-based propulsion solutions. A key growth contributor is rising deployment of hybrid electric propulsion systems, which are becoming essential for next-generation aircraft and spacecraft designs focused on reducing carbon emissions and operational costs.
Advancements in battery technology and power electronics are significantly improving system performance and energy density. Lightweight materials and high-efficiency motors are also enhancing thrust-to-weight ratios, making electric propulsion more viable for long-duration missions. Aerospace companies are investing heavily in R&D to develop scalable propulsion systems for satellites, UAVs, and commercial aircraft.
The integration of artificial intelligence and smart energy management systems is further optimizing propulsion efficiency. These technologies help in predictive maintenance, energy optimization, and improved system reliability, reducing overall operational risks.
Regional Insights
North America leads the market due to strong aerospace innovation and defense spending. Europe follows with aggressive emission reduction policies and sustainable aviation initiatives. Asia-Pacific is rapidly growing due to expanding satellite programs and increasing investments in space exploration. The Middle East is emerging in space technology adoption, while Latin America is gradually investing in aerospace modernization programs.
